confidence interval:
This tells us the degree of certainty or uncertainty that is existent in a sampling method. It gives us a range of values, telling us we are fairly sure that our true value or parameter lies within the range.
Degree of confidence:
This tells us that the confidence interval has captured the true/exact population parameter.
If we have 95% degree of confidence, we are 95% sure that that the exact/true parameter are in the confidence interval
